Jurgen Klopp wants Liverpool to sign Chelsea star whose Chelsea future at Stamford Bridge remains uncertain
Liverpool manager Jurgen Klopp is reportedly keen on Chelsea winger Callum Hudson-Odoi ahead of the January transfer window.
Hudson-Odoi didn’t star as Thomas Tuchel’s side overcame Tottenham 3-0 to go top of the Premier League on Sunday, with the winger having strived for minutes so far this season.
Hudson-Odoi has made just two appearances for Chelsea since the start of the new season, having started the Super Cup triumph over Villarreal and the 3-0 win against Aston Villa nine days ago.
The 20-year-old was believed to be close to joining Borussia Dortmund on loan ahead of the transfer deadline, but Tuchel declined to sanction the move, saying it was “impossible” to let him go.
Hudson-Odoi was selected at right wing-back for the home encounter against Villa, which was Chelsea’s first match after the transfer window closed.
But Sunday’s victory over Spurs suggested he still faces a fight to carve out a place in Tuchel’s team, with N’Golo Kante and Timo Werner coming on for Mason Mount and Kai Havertz, while Hudson-Odoi remained on the bench.
The winger was also left out of key matches towards the end of last term – including all of Chelsea’s Champions League games from the quarter-finals to when they beat Manchester City in the final in Porto.

He faces competition from Mount, Havertz, Werner, Hakim Ziyech and Christian Pulisic for a place in Chelsea’s attack alongside Romelu Lukaku, while Cesar Azpilicueta and Reece James are Tuchel’s favored options at right wing-back.
Despite Tuchel having ruled out a summer move, speculation has continued over Hudson-Odoi’s future, with Liverpool manager Klopp said to be keen on a move.
That’s according to Calcio Mercato, which claims the Reds are carefully considering whether to raid their Premier League rivals for his signature.
Liverpool were also associated with interest in Hudson-Odoi in the summer, having reportedly held discussions with his agent two-and-a-half years ago after Bayern Munich had a bid declined.
It seems doubtful the Stamford Bridge outfit would sanction a move for the winger to one of their title rivals, with Chelsea and Liverpool currently neck and neck at the top of the table.
And after Hudson-Odoi impressed against Villa, Tuchel spoke about why he had refused to let him join Dortmund.
“We have spoken. It was a very easy decision for me to make on the last day of the transfer period,” said the manager.
“We cannot let a player who is in the 18/19 man squad leave. He is able to play as a right wing-back, a left wing-back, in the two 10 positions.
“He knows the group, we know him very well. There was no chance to say yes on the last day.
“For him personally, it may have been a good opportunity but for us and our targets that we want to achieve, it was simply impossible. It was an easy one for me actually.”
